.. _enum_Camera2D_AnchorMode:
enum **AnchorMode**
enum **AnchorMode**:
- **ANCHOR_MODE_FIXED_TOP_LEFT** = **0** --- The camera's position is fixed so that the top-left corner is always at the origin.
- **ANCHOR_MODE_DRAG_CENTER** = **1** --- The camera's position takes into account vertical/horizontal offsets and the screen size.

.. _class_Camera2D_zoom:
- :ref:`Vector2<class_Vector2>` **zoom** - The camera's zoom relative to the viewport. Values larger than ``Vector2(1, 1)`` zoom out and smaller values zoom in. For an example, use ``Vector2(0.5, 0.5)`` for a 2x zoom in, and ``Vector2(4, 4)`` for a 4x zoom out.
- :ref:`Vector2<class_Vector2>` **zoom**
+----------+-----------------+
| *Setter* | set_zoom(value) |
+----------+-----------------+
| *Getter* | get_zoom() |
+----------+-----------------+
The camera's zoom relative to the viewport. Values larger than ``Vector2(1, 1)`` zoom out and smaller values zoom in. For an example, use ``Vector2(0.5, 0.5)`` for a 2x zoom in, and ``Vector2(4, 4)`` for a 4x zoom out.
